Subject: [PATCH v10 05/12] iommu: Add IOMMU SVA domain support
Date: Tue,  5 Jul 2022 13:07:03 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20220705050710.2887204-6-baolu.lu@linux.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220705050710.2887204-1-baolu.lu@linux.intel.com>

The sva iommu_domain represents a hardware pagetable that the IOMMU
hardware could use for SVA translation. This adds some infrastructure
to support SVA domain in the iommu common layer. It includes:

- Extend the iommu_domain to support a new I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A domain
  type. The IOMMU drivers that support allocation of the SVA domain
  should provide its own sva domain specific iommu_domain_ops.
- Add a helper to allocate an SVA domain. The iommu_domain_free()
  is still used to free an SVA domain.

The report_iommu_fault() should be replaced by the new
iommu_report_device_fault(). Leave the existing fault handler with the
existing users and the newly added SVA members excludes it.

---
 include/linux/iommu.h | 24 ++++++++++++++++++++++--
 drivers/iommu/iommu.c | 20 ++++++++++++++++++++
 2 files changed, 42 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/iommu.h b/include/linux/iommu.h
index f2b5aa7efe43..42f0418dc22c 100644
--- a/include/linux/iommu.h
+++ b/include/linux/iommu.h
@@ -64,6 +64,8 @@ struct iommu_domain_geometry {
 #define __IOMMU_DOMAIN_PT	(1U << 2)  /* Domain is identity mapped   */
 #define __I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A_FQ	(1U << 3)  /* DMA-API uses flush queue    */
 
+#define __I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A	(1U << 4)  /* Shared process address space */
+
 /*
  * This are the possible domain-types
  *
@@ -77,6 +79,8 @@ struct iommu_domain_geometry {
  *				  certain optimizations for these domains
  *	I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A_FQ	- As above, but definitely using batched TLB
  *				  invalidation.
+ *	I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A	- DMA addresses are shared process address
+ *				  spaces represented by mm_struct's.
  */
 #define IOMMU_DOMAIN_BLOCKED	(0U)
 #define IOMMU_DOMAIN_IDENTITY	(__IOMMU_DOMAIN_PT)
@@ -86,15 +90,23 @@ struct iommu_domain_geometry {
 #define I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A_FQ	(__IOMMU_DOMAIN_PAGING |	\
 				 __I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A_API |	\
 				 __I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A_FQ)
+#define I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A	(__I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A)
 
 struct iommu_domain {
 	unsigned type;
 	const struct iommu_domain_ops *ops;
 	unsigned long pgsize_bitmap;	/* Bitmap of page sizes in use */
-	iommu_fault_handler_t handler;
-	void *handler_token;
 	struct iommu_domain_geometry geometry;
 	struct iommu_dma_cookie *iova_cookie;
+	union {
+		struct {
+			iommu_fault_handler_t handler;
+			void *handler_token;
+		};
+		struct {	/* I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A */
+			struct mm_struct *mm;
+		};
+	};
 };
 
 static inline bool iommu_is_dma_domain(struct iommu_domain *domain)
@@ -685,6 +697,8 @@ int iommu_group_claim_dma_owner(struct iommu_group *group, void *owner);
 void iommu_group_release_dma_owner(struct iommu_group *group);
 bool iommu_group_dma_owner_claimed(struct iommu_group *group);
 
+struct iommu_domain *iommu_sva_domain_alloc(struct device *dev,
+					    struct mm_struct *mm);
 int iommu_attach_device_pasid(struct iommu_domain *domain, struct device *dev,
 			      ioasid_t pasid);
 void iommu_detach_device_pasid(struct iommu_domain *domain, struct device *dev,
@@ -1063,6 +1077,12 @@ static inline bool iommu_group_dma_owner_claimed(struct iommu_group *group)
 	return false;
 }
 
+static inline struct iommu_domain *
+iommu_sva_domain_alloc(struct device *dev, struct mm_struct *mm)
+{
+	return NULL;
+}
+
 static inline int iommu_attach_device_pasid(struct iommu_domain *domain,
 					    struct device *dev, ioasid_t pasid)
 {
diff --git a/drivers/iommu/iommu.c b/drivers/iommu/iommu.c
index be48b09371f4..10479c5e4d23 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/iommu.c
+++ b/drivers/iommu/iommu.c
@@ -27,6 +27,7 @@
 #include <linux/module.h>
 #include <linux/cc_platform.h>
 #include <trace/events/iommu.h>
+#include <linux/sched/mm.h>
 
 static struct kset *iommu_group_kset;
 static DEFINE_IDA(iommu_group_ida);
@@ -1957,6 +1958,8 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(iommu_domain_alloc);
 
 void iommu_domain_free(struct iommu_domain *domain)
 {
+	if (domain->type == I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A)
+		mmdrop(domain->mm);
 	iommu_put_dma_cookie(domain);
 	domain->ops->free(domain);
 }
@@ -3274,6 +3277,23 @@ bool iommu_group_dma_owner_claimed(struct iommu_group *group)
 }
 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(iommu_group_dma_owner_claimed);
 
+struct iommu_domain *iommu_sva_domain_alloc(struct device *dev,
+					    struct mm_struct *mm)
+{
+	const struct iommu_ops *ops = dev_iommu_ops(dev);
+	struct iommu_domain *domain;
+
+	domain = ops->domain_alloc(I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A);
+	if (!domain)
+		return NULL;
+
+	domain->type = I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A;
+	mmgrab(mm);
+	domain->mm = mm;
+
+	return domain;
+}
+
 static bool iommu_group_immutable_singleton(struct iommu_group *group,
 					    struct device *dev)
 {
-- 
2.25.1
